Fig. 1. Biobank establishment of small round cell sarcoma cancer tumoroids.

Fig. 1

A Flow diagram with an overview of the study design. Tumoroids were established from patient tumor and PDX material and subsequently characterized using whole genome sequencing, RNA sequencing and histology. Drug screens were performed on a subset of ES, CDS and BRS. Lastly, primary tumors and matching tumoroid lines were viably frozen and stored in liquid nitrogen. Created in BioRender. Ringnalda, F. (2025) https://BioRender.com/ovfd63d. B Donut chart (left) representing the different fusions and the number of patients per fusion that were included in the ES, CDS and BRS biobank. Bar chart (right) of the total number of established tumoroid lines from each fusion, subdivided in tumoroids derived from patient tumors and those derived from PDX material. C Representative brightfield microscopy images of EWSR1::FLI1, EWSR1::ERG, EWSR1::FEV, BCOR::CCNB3, KMT2D::BCOR and CIC::DUX4 tumoroids (n = 3, frames of individual area of interest). Scale bar: 200 µm, zoom-in 100 µm. ES Ewing sarcoma, CDS CIC::DUX4 sarcoma, BRS BCOR-rearranged sarcoma. Source data are provided as a Source Data file.
